Web25 apr. 2024 · Transactional practice is essentially the creation and review of documents that bring people and companies together (merger and acquisitions, private equity, etc.), while litigation focuses on the process of resolving disputes, often in a courtroom setting.

Web6 okt. 2024 · In terms of legal practice, one important distinction is between a litigation practice, focused on resolving business disputes, and a transactional practice, focused on negotiating and implementing business transactions or providing advice on the organization or governance of a business organization. Most business lawyers focus on one or the other. philip morris glassWeb25 aug. 2024 · Litigation vs transactional law is in terms of their specialties, both can benefit a business.
